海外域名注册如何实现CDN智能调度?全球加速的实战解析

引言

随着全球化布局的推进,很多站长和企业选择在海外注册域名并结合 CDN 实现全球加速。无论是从香港服务器、美国服务器,还是日本服务器、韩国服务器、新加坡服务器、菲律宾马尼拉服务器等节点访问,如何通过智能调度让用户就近命中边缘节点、降低延迟、提高可用性,成为提升体验的关键。本文将从原理、实际部署要点、应用场景、优势对比以及选购建议等方面,深入解析“海外域名注册如何实现 CDN 智能调度”的实战策略,面向站长、企业用户与开发者,给出可落地的技术细节与最佳实践。

原理解析:DNS + CDN 的智能调度机制

实现 CDN 智能调度,核心在于 DNS 层面的地理定位与实时策略匹配。常见实现方式包括 GeoDNS(基于地理位置的 DNS)、Anycast DNS 与基于延迟/负载的智能解析。

GeoDNS 与 Anycast 的差异

GeoDNS 根据查询来源的 IP 地理位置返回不同的解析记录,适合做“就近访问”调度;而 Anycast 则是通过把同一 IP 广泛发布到多个 PoP(点位),由网络层路由选择最近的节点,适用于降低解析时间与提升抗 DDoS 能力。两者可组合使用:Anycast DNS 提升解析的稳定性与速度,GeoDNS 做精细的地域分发策略。

基于性能的动态调度

更高级的 CDN 智能调度会结合实时的监控数据(如 RTT、丢包率、服务端负载、健康检查结果),通过调度算法(最小延迟、负载均衡、轮询、权重)动态调整域名解析结果。实现方式通常为:

  • 边缘探测:在各个 PoP 主动探测到各个源站或中转节点的网络质量。
  • 健康检查:定期对源站(例如部署在香港VPS、美国VPS或菲律宾马尼拉服务器上的服务)做 HTTP/HTTPS/TCP 探测,确定节点可用性。
  • 策略下发:通过集中控制平面下发解析规则(如把日本用户指向离日本最近的 PoP,韩国用户指向韩国 PoP)。

DNS TTL 与缓存控制

DNS TTL 决定解析变更的生效速度。短 TTL(如 30-60 秒)便于快速切换,但会增加解析压力;长 TTL(如 300-3600 秒)减少解析量但降低切换灵活性。实践中,可针对静态资源使用较长 TTL,针对需要快速故障切换的主域或 API 使用短 TTL,并结合 HTTP 缓存头(Cache-Control)实现端到端的缓存策略。

实战部署要点

下面列举具体可操作的部署步骤与注意事项,帮助你把域名注册与 CDN 调度结合起来实现全球加速。

1. 海外域名注册与 DNS 服务选择

首先在可靠的域名注册商进行海外域名注册(例如为面向美洲用户注册 .com/.us,为亚洲用户选择合适后缀)。选择支持 Anycast 与 GeoDNS 的 DNS 服务商,确保解析层面能够做地域定向与快速切换。对于需要合规或低延迟的场景,域名与 DNS 解析最好靠近业务目标地域(如香港服务器或日本服务器附近的 DNS 节点)。

2. 架构设计:多源站与全球 PoP 分布

构建多源站(origin)可以提升可用性与性能,例如把主站部署在美国服务器,同时在香港VPS、新加坡服务器或菲律宾马尼拉服务器部署缓存节点或镜像站点。CDN 作为全局分发层,在边缘布置 PoP,使用智能调度将用户导向最近或性能最好的边缘节点。

3. 健康检测与自动切换

配置多层次的健康检测:

  • 边缘到源站的 RTT/丢包监测。
  • 应用层的可用性检查(返回码、页面关键字符串)。
  • 源站间的优先级与权重配置。

当某个源站(例如位于韩国服务器或美国VPS 的节点)检测到不可用时,GeoDNS 或控制平面可自动下发新解析,把流量切到其他可用源。

4. TLS/证书与安全

全球访问时要统一 TLS 策略。建议使用 CDN 提供的通配证书或统一的证书管理平台,结合自动化的证书续期(ACME)来覆盖主域名与子域。对于对安全性要求高的站点,可启用 DNSSEC 来防止 DNS 污染或劫持,Anycast DNS 有助于提升抗 DDoS 能力。

5. 日志、监控与回溯

部署细粒度监控与日志收集:边缘请求日志、后端日志、DNS 解析日志与探测数据。结合可视化平台做 SLA 报表和热点分析,便于发现某个地域(比如日本服务器访问时间异常)的问题并优化调度策略。

应用场景与优势对比

不同业务场景对 CDN 智能调度的侧重点不同,下面列出几个常见场景与建议。

静态内容分发(网站、图片、视频)

  • 侧重边缘缓存率与访问延迟,优先使用边缘缓存与长 TTL。
  • 在热门地区(如日本、韩国、新加坡)部署更多 PoP,提高命中率。

全球化 Web 应用与 API

  • 侧重动态调度与低延迟,TTL 较短,结合 Anycast 与性能探测实现基于延迟的解析。
  • API 可将不同区域的用户路由到就近的服务器(例如把欧美流量导向美国服务器,把亚太流量导向香港服务器或菲律宾马尼拉服务器)。

灾备与高可用

  • 结合 GeoDNS 和健康检查实现自动故障切换,多个源站分布在香港VPS、美国VPS 等地。
  • Anycast 提升解析稳定性并减少单点故障影响。

选购建议:如何选择服务与节点

在选择海外域名注册、DNS 与 CDN 服务时,应从以下维度评估:

  • 覆盖范围与 PoP 分布:关注是否覆盖目标用户集中的区域(例如面向亚太用户要有日本服务器、韩国服务器、新加坡服务器 与 菲律宾马尼拉服务器 等 PoP)。
  • 解析与调度能力:是否支持 GeoDNS、Anycast、基于性能的动态调度与自定义策略。
  • 健康检查与自动化:是否提供灵活的探测策略与自动切换,支持短 TTL 配置。
  • 安全与合规:是否支持 DDoS 防护、TLS 管理、DNSSEC 与本地合规性需求(例如香港服务器的合规策略)。
  • 运维与可视化:是否提供实时监控、日志导出能力与报警机制,便于快速定位问题。

同时在源站选型上,根据业务特性选择合适的海外服务器或 VPS。静态站点与缓存层可优先选择成本较低的香港VPS、新加坡服务器等;对延迟敏感的交互应用可在美国VPS或日本服务器等地建设更多近源节点。

总结

要实现海外域名注册后的 CDN 智能调度,关键在于把 DNS 的地理定位、Anycast 技术与基于性能的动态调度结合起来,同时辅以完善的健康检查、TLS 管理与监控体系。通过在合适的地区(如香港、美国、日本、韩国、新加坡、菲律宾马尼拉等)部署源站与边缘 PoP,并针对不同业务制定 TTL、缓存策略和故障切换规则,可以显著提升全球访问性能与可用性。

如果你需要进一步了解海外域名注册与全球加速的具体产品与部署方案,可访问后浪云的海外域名注册服务页面了解详情:https://idc.net/domain

THE END